Functional Food Ingredients Market to Reach USD 232.40 Billion by 2034

A Market on a Strong Growth Trajectory
The global functional food ingredients market is experiencing dynamic expansion as consumers increasingly prioritize nutrition, preventive health, and overall well-being. Valued at USD 119.25 billion in 2024, the market is projected to climb to USD 127.48 billion in 2025 and surge to an impressive USD 232.40 billion by 2034, reflecting a robust CAGR of 6.9%. According to a recent study by Towards FnB, the surge in health-conscious lifestyles, rising disposable incomes, and shifting dietary habits are key forces propelling this decade-long growth.

Understanding Functional Food Ingredients
Functional food ingredients are bioactive components added to foods and beverages to deliver benefits beyond basic nutrition. These ingredients—ranging from probiotics and omega-3 fatty acids to vitamins, antioxidants, and dietary fibers—support cognitive wellness, heart health, digestion, immunity, and weight management. As sedentary lifestyles and diet-related health challenges grow worldwide, consumers are increasingly turning to functional foods as convenient solutions for preventive health and holistic nutrition. Rising awareness about the relationship between diet and long-term wellness remains a major catalyst, encouraging brands and manufacturers to innovate with fortified, nutrient-dense, and clean-label formulations.

Market Highlights and Segment Landscape
The functional food ingredients market is rapidly evolving, shaped by rising health awareness, scientific advancements, and shifting consumer preferences. In 2024, Asia Pacific led the market with a 33% revenue share, driven by growing health concerns and urbanization, particularly in India and China. Probiotics dominated the ingredient segment with 32%, while synbiotics are gaining traction as gut health becomes a global priority. Natural ingredients accounted for 45% of the market, highlighting the strong move toward clean-label, plant-based solutions. Powder-based formats remained most popular for their versatility in beverages, supplements, and fortified foods, with functional beverages capturing the highest application share at 25% and dairy alternatives continuing to rise. Digestive health was the leading functional benefit as consumers increasingly prioritize gut wellness. Food and beverage manufacturers held the largest end-user share at 55%, supported by continuous innovation, while direct B2B channels dominated distribution even as online platforms grow rapidly in influence.

Emerging Trends Reshaping the Market
A new wave of trends is influencing the direction of the functional food ingredients landscape:Consumer preference is shifting toward products with natural, organic, and sustainable ingredients, driving the clean-label movement. Veganism and plant-based diets continue to grow, boosting the use of botanical extracts, plant proteins, and plant-derived micronutrients. Additionally, consumers are increasingly adopting functional beverages—such as fortified juices, energy drinks, kombucha, and plant-based milks—as everyday wellness boosters.

The Transformative Role of Artificial Intelligence
Artificial intelligence (AI) is revolutionizing the functional food ecosystem, from ingredient discovery to product personalization. AI-driven research can quickly analyze consumer health data, clinical studies, and global dietary patterns to identify new bioactive compounds and develop highly optimized formulations. Personalized nutrition—powered by AI—enables brands to tailor products to individual health profiles.
In manufacturing, AI enhances process efficiency, ensures consistent product quality, and reduces operational downtime through predictive maintenance. These advancements are accelerating innovation and enabling companies to bring novel functional foods to market faster.

Regulatory Challenges and Market Constraints
Despite significant growth opportunities, the market faces regulatory complexities. Global agencies enforce strict safety, efficacy, and labeling standards to ensure consumer protection. Meeting compliance requirements often involves extensive research, documentation, and testing—processes that can be both time-consuming and costly. Such challenges may slow product launches and restrict smaller manufacturers from scaling quickly.

Opportunities Powered by Innovation
Technological advancements offer vast opportunities for the functional food ingredients market. Breakthroughs in biotechnology, encapsulation techniques, and fermentation are improving bioavailability, enhancing ingredient stability, and expanding innovation for cleaner, healthier, and more effective functional products. The continued rise of functional food startups, alongside increased investment in health-focused FMCG innovation, is further expanding the market landscape.

Asia Pacific: The Growth Engine of the Global Market
Asia Pacific’s dominant position in 2024 is expected to strengthen through 2034. Rapid urbanization, growing health concerns, and a fast-expanding consumer base looking for nutritious, convenient food options are key drivers. India and China are at the forefront, with manufacturers integrating ingredients like omega-3s, probiotics, and essential vitamins to address regional nutritional gaps. As wellness becomes central to daily food choices, the region is emerging as a powerful hub for functional food innovation.
